in our earth matters series, the world s leading climate scientists today warning the climate crisis is accelerating at an alarming pace. with the earth warming more than previously thought. those details in a landmark u.n. report which the secretary general calls a, quote, code red for humanity. and we re seeing the effects right now with fires burning around the globe. in california the dixie fire has burned close to half a million acres of land, more than twice the size of new york city. and in europe, the second largest island in greece is on fire. thousands of residents forced to evacuate as homes and buildings are destroyed. and in iran the largest lake in the middle east has shrunk to half its size dried up from years of severe drought. cnn s frederik pleitgen is there with a look at how the once-popular beach resort is now

Current global environmental law and policy are failing, experts say

IMAGE:  Environmental Policy and Law special issue - Our Earth Matters: Pathways to a Better Common Environmental Future. We need to accept with all humility our sacred duty for the care,. view more  Credit: IOS Press Amsterdam, June 2, 2021 - On the eve of the 50th anniversary of the 1972 Stockholm conference that created the United Nations Environmental Programme, it is clear that the global environmental situation has only deteriorated. In Our Earth Matters: Pathways to a Better Common Environmental Future, an extended special issue of Environmental Policy and Law (EPL), leading scholars from more than five continents call for an honest introspection of what has been attained over the last 50 years relating to regulatory processes and laws and explore future trajectories with new ideas and frameworks for environmental governance in the 21st century.

Earth Matters: What to Know About Carbon Offsets | Nyack News and Views

If Earth Matters to you, It was about a decade ago that carbon offsets became a “thing.” Travelers at San Francisco International Airport could step up to a kiosk and buy carbon offsets to balance out that greenhouse gas-spewing flight. (How does 1,000 pounds of CO2 on an LA-to-Chicago trip sound?)  The idea of an offset is that you can cancel out the harmful effect of your emissions by supporting a project that will eliminate an equivalent amount of emissions elsewhere in the world. But offsets pose practical and moral problems: If harmful pollution is wrong, can you really right that wrong by paying someone else not to pollute?
